Do OC graphics card come overclocked?

The OC edition comes with a factory overclock, so even without overclocking software it runs faster. Typically, they also use “binned” chips which either the chip or board maker rate higher for clock and reliability. OC GPUs often have better cooling and higher power capacity.

    Can I overclock a factory overclocked card?

    Yes, you can overclock a factory overclocked or already overclocked graphics card but this may not apply to all factory overclocked graphics cards. This is because some overclocked graphics cards have some room left for overclocking and some don’t.

    Does overclocking a graphics card damage it?

    The most common cause of GPU death when overclocking is when the power delivery components aren’t kept cool enough while having to feed high voltages and they fail, the next cause would probably be from using too high a voltage, which can certainly cause immediate and permanent damage to the GPU core.
